WebJan 7, 2024 · The backer board and tile will raise your floor 3/4-in. or more, so you’ll have to remove and undercut the door. To mark the door for cutting, stack backer board, tile and two layers of cardboard on the floor (see Photo 3). Mark the door 1/2-in. above the stack, remove the door and cut off the bottom. Step 2. WebJan 10, 2024 · Warm up cold bathroom floors with electric in-floor heating mats installed under the tile. Use it as supplemental heat for comfort or as space heat to warm the entire bathroom. Installation is as easy as laying tile. Tools Required Cordless drill Hot melt glue gun Margin trowel Trowel Utility knife Volt-ohm meter (or continuity tester)

WebFor bathroom floors, attaching an underlayment of cement board (backer board) to your sub-flooring will also provide a level and sturdy surface for your tiles to adhere to. Using a circular saw can help you cut panels that will fit your bathroom floor and cut holes as needed to accommodate the toilet and other bath fixtures.
